Travel today on an Anderson Coach motorcoach to Avon, OH. Enjoy fun-filled day at the park with a Lake Erie Crushers Baseball Game. The Crushers compete in the Frontier League as a member of the Central Division in the Midwest Conference. ForeFront Field opened for the team’s debut in 2009. Avon is the world headquarters of the Duck Tape Corporation, and the team’s ballpark hosts the Duck Tape Festival each June.

The team also features many promotional events throughout the season from outstanding weekly promotions, theme nights, giveaways, and lots of fireworks! This season, every weekend home game (Fridays and Saturdays) will feature Postgame Fireworks with an energetic, themed music track that embodies the theme of the night. Every Sunday is Sunday Family Fun Day where all kids ages 12 and under eat FREE, get to run the bases after the game, and can get autographs from all their favorite players. And before the game, all ticketed fans can enjoy a game of catch on the field – just bring your glove!
